Start your trip in Zurich, the largest city in Switzerland. In the morning, take a leisurely stroll along the shores of Lake Zurich, enjoying the peaceful atmosphere and stunning views of the mountains. In the afternoon, visit the Old Town (Altstadt) to explore the charming historical streets and visit the Grossmünster, a Romanesque-style Protestant church. As the evening sets in, relax at one of the city's rooftop bars, such as Jules Verne Panoramabar, for panoramic vistas of the city.
Head to Lucerne, a picturesque city known for its stunning lake and medieval architecture. In the morning, take a relaxing boat ride on Lake Lucerne, surrounded by snow-capped mountains. In the afternoon, visit the famous Chapel Bridge (Kapellbrücke), a covered wooden bridge dating back to the 14th century. As the evening sets in, explore the charming streets of the Old Town and enjoy a cozy dinner at one of the local restaurants.
Travel to Interlaken, a stunning town situated between two alpine lakes. In the morning, take a relaxing walk around Lake Thun or Lake Brienz, enjoying the serene surroundings. In the afternoon, visit Harder Kulm, a mountain viewpoint offering breathtaking views of the Jungfrau region. As the evening sets in, unwind at one of the local spas, such as the Victoria-Jungfrau Grand Hotel & Spa, for a rejuvenating experience.
Visit the enchanting mountain village of Zermatt, known for its iconic Matterhorn peak. In the morning, take a cable car ride to Gornergrat for breathtaking panoramic views of the surrounding Alps. In the afternoon, explore the car-free village and indulge in some Swiss chocolate shopping. As the evening sets in, relax at one of the cozy chalet-style restaurants, such as Restaurant Whymper-Stube, for a taste of local cuisine.
Head to Montreux, a charming town nestled on the shores of Lake Geneva. In the morning, visit Chillon Castle, a medieval fortress surrounded by the lake. In the afternoon, take a leisurely stroll along the scenic lakeside promenade, lined with beautiful flowers and sculptures. As the evening sets in, relax at one of the lakeside cafes, such as Café du Lac, and enjoy the stunning sunset views.
Visit Geneva, a cosmopolitan city famous for its diplomacy and beautiful lake. In the morning, take a relaxing boat cruise on Lake Geneva, enjoying the stunning views of the Jet d'Eau fountain. In the afternoon, explore the Old Town (Vieille Ville) with its narrow streets and visit St. Pierre Cathedral. As the evening sets in, enjoy a peaceful walk along the lakefront promenade and savor a delicious Swiss fondue dinner at a local restaurant.
End your trip in Basel, a vibrant city located on the Rhine River. In the morning, visit the Kunstmuseum Basel, one of the oldest and largest art museums in Europe. In the afternoon, explore the beautiful Old Town with its well-preserved medieval buildings. As the evening sets in, relax at one of the local beer gardens, such as Volta Bräu, and enjoy a refreshing drink while watching the river flow by.
